Is It Hard to Get Into Middle Georgia State University?

100% Acceptance Rate
57% Of Accepted Are Women
29% Submit SAT Scores

Acceptance Rate

With an acceptance rate of 100%, Middle Georgia State University has a fairly liberal admissions policy. However, don't just assume you'll get in! Put together a good application and make sure you include all requested documents and materials.

Average Test Scores

About 29% of students accepted to Middle Georgia State University submitted their SAT scores. When looking at the 25th through the 75th percentile, SAT Evidence-Based Reading and Writing scores ranged between 460 and 580. Math scores were between 450 and 560.

Middle Georgia State University received ACT scores from 11% of accepted students. When looking at the 25th through the 75th percentile, ACT Composite scores ranged between 15 and 23.

Student to Faculty Ratio

The student to faculty ratio at Middle Georgia State University is about average at 18 to 1. This ratio is often used to gauge how many students might be in an average class and how much time professors will have to spend with their students on an individual level. The national average for this metric is 15 to 1.

Percent of Full-Time Faculty

Another measure that is often used to estimate how much access students will have to their professors is how many faculty members are full-time. The idea here is that part-time faculty tend to spend less time on campus, so they may not be as available to students as full-timers.

The full-time faculty percentage at Middle Georgia State University is 72%. This is higher than the national average of 47%.

Freshmen Retention Rate

The freshmen retention rate is a sign of how many full-time students like a college or university well enough to come back for their sophomore year. At Middle Georgia State University this rate is 61%, which is a bit lower than the national average of 68%.

Graduation Rate

The on-time graduation rate is the percent of first-time, full time students who obtain their bachelor's degree in four years or less. This rate is 11% for first-time, full-time students at Middle Georgia State University, which is lower than the national rate of 33.3%.

During the 2017-2018 academic year, there were 8,015 undergraduates at Middle Georgia State University with 4,802 being full-time and 3,213 being part-time.

Student Loan Debt

It's not uncommon for college students to take out loans to pay for school. In fact, almost 66% of students nationwide depend at least partially on loans. At Middle Georgia State University, approximately 44% of students took out student loans averaging $5,208 a year. That adds up to $20,832 over four years for those students.

The student loan default rate at Middle Georgia State University is 2.0%. This is significantly lower than the national default rate of 10.1%, which is a good sign that you'll be able to pay back your student loans.

Middle Georgia State University is a public institution situated in Macon, Georgia. The city atmosphere of Macon makes it a great place for students who enjoy having lots of educational and entertainment options.

Online Learning at Middle Georgia State University

73% Take At Least One Class Online
43% Take All Classes Online

Online learning is becoming popular at even the oldest colleges and universities in the United States. Not only are online classes great for returning adults with busy schedules, they are also frequented by a growing number of traditional students.

In 2022-2023, 5,607 students took at least one online class at Middle Georgia State University. This is a decrease from the 5,635 students who took online classes the previous year.

YearTook at Least One Online ClassTook All Classes Online
2022-20235,6073,341
2021-20225,6353,274
2020-20216,0363,373
2018-20194,1331,598
